Buying Guide: Key Purchase Considerations

  • Anchor capacity vs. boat size: Match the winch’s pound rating to your anchor and boat weight. Higher capacity is favorable for larger craft or heavier anchors but may require sturdier mounting.
  • Power and motor type: A 12V DC motor is standard; evaluate energy efficiency and battery availability for longer trips.
  • Rope length and material: Ensure the pre-wound rope length suits typical docking distances. Nylon or double-braid lines offer good strength and stretch properties.
  • Remote control options: Wired or wireless remotes add convenience; consider range and interference in marina environments.
  • Safety features: Look for automatic reset breakers and anti-reverse clutches to prevent accidental free winding and electrical damage.
  • Mounting and installation: Confirm space, davit compatibility, and wiring layout on your boat to avoid interference with other gear.
  • Durability and environment: Saltwater use requires corrosion-resistant construction and sealed components to withstand marine conditions.

Frequently Asked Questions

  1. What is an automatic anchor winch?

    An automatic anchor winch pulls and releases the anchor with the push of a button, often including a wireless remote and pre-wound rope for quick deployment and retrieval.

  2. What boat size is best for these winches?

    Most units shown are suited for small to mid-sized boats, pontoons, and deckboats. Check capacity ratings against your boat’s weight and typical load.

  3. Do these require professional installation?

    Installation complexity varies. Some kits are designed for DIY mounting with basic wiring, while others may need specialized mounting to ensure safety and reliability.

  4. What maintenance is needed?

    Regularly inspect mounting hardware, check rope condition, and ensure the motor and gears remain free of corrosion and debris. Replace worn ropes promptly.

  5. Can I use a wireless remote in rough seas?

    Wireless remotes may be affected by interference or water exposure. Use wired controls as a reliable backup in challenging conditions.

  6. How do I determine the right capacity?

    Choose a winch with a capacity greater than your anchor’s weight and consider scenarios like gusty winds and rough currents that increase load.
